Subject: [RFC PATCH -next 00/16] mm/damon: support ARM32 with LPAE
Date: Wed, 13 Aug 2025 13:06:50 +0800	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20250813050706.1564229-1-yanquanmin1@huawei.com> (raw)

Previously, DAMON's physical address space monitoring only supported
memory ranges below 4GB on LPAE-enabled systems. This was due to
the use of 'unsigned long' in 'struct damon_addr_range', which is
32-bit on ARM32 even with LPAE enabled.

Implements DAMON compatibility for ARM32 with LPAE enabled.

Patches 01/16 through 10/16 are from the mailing list[1], add a new core
layer parameter called 'addr_unit'. Operations set layer can translate a
core layer address to the real address by multiplying the parameter value
to the core layer address.

Patches 11/16 through 14/16 extend and complement patches 01~10, addressing
various issues introduced by the addr_unit implementation.

Patches 15/16 and 16/16 complete native DAMON support for 32-bit systems.
